| Summary: The Bureau of Land Management (BLM) Spokane District, in a joint cooperative initiative with Ducks Unlimited (DU) and Washington Department of Fish and Wildlife (WDFW), is proposing to restore depressional wetlands to their historical condition on Bureau of Land Management and Swanson Lakes Wildlife Management Area lands. This environmental assessment addresses only that portion of the wetland restoration on Bureau of Land Management lands. The project area is in Lincoln County, WA. It is within the Lake Creek drainage, about 6 miles south of Highway 2, 12 miles west of Davenport, and 45 miles west of Spokane. | |
